A herd of wild elephants from the Nepal border in Kishanganj has created a huge uproar. Elephants entered many villages and ruined the crops of farmers, causing loss of lakhs of rupees. Villagers are in panic due to elephants terror and are forced to do overnight.

Elephants entered 8-10 kilometers inside

According to the information received, a herd of 7 wild elephants from Nepal border entered many villages including Padampur, Baramasia, Ichamari, Estate Padampur, Talbari in Digalabank block at around 4 am on Sunday. Elephants trampled the crop of maize and banana in the fields, causing heavy economic damage to the farmers.

The tragedy is repeated every year, administration careless

Villagers say that every year a herd of wild elephants from Nepal enters and ruins crops. In the past, many people have lost their lives in elephant attacks, but the administration has not been able to take any concrete steps so far. This time too, the forest department team did not reach the spot until the news was written, due to which there is anger among the villagers. The farmers have demanded relief and compensation from the administration at the earliest, as well as appealed to take effective steps to drive away elephants.
